Resumo: Athletes who use wheelchairs and compete in the throwing events for seated athlete use equipment called throwing frame. This equipment aims to provide the athlete greater stability and freedom during the throw. Currently, throwing frame have simple configurations and generally do not consider athletes' anthropometric characteristics. The goal of this research is to develop a new equipment, called THFRAME, designed to evaluate the athlete's seated posture, adapt to his anthropometric measurements through adjustable elements and monitor the pressure under the seat to customize throwing frame. THFRAME was developed following rules defined by the International Paralympic Committee. The structural part of the equipment was evaluated using finite element modeling and the structure proved to be rigid for the imposed loads. The equipment was manufactured and the first tests performed with athletes indicated that the adjustments of the THFRAME provided safety and comfort for them. During the evaluation of the athletes, the pressure distribution under the seat showed an increase of the contact area in the buttocks and thighs, indicating that the athlete's seated support base was optimized through the adjustments of the equipment. The seated condition with adjustments presented lower contact pressure values to the condition without posture adjustments, yet the pressure values found in this evaluation are considered critical for the formation of pressure injuries. The analysis of different pressure levels under the seat of THFRAME indicates that the postural adjustments provided by the equipment improved support base, essential for the function of the upper limbs. The evaluation of the parameters mentioned above allowed the prescription of customized throwing frames for athletes.
